What moves the price

Mileage

Asking prices run about $33,008 under 15K miles and fall to $23,999 over 105K miles — roughly $900 for every 10,000 miles. These are different vehicles; trim, condition and equipment also vary.

Observed spread: up to $9,009

Location

Typical asking prices are $26,795 in Rhode Island but $34,998 in Hawaii. These are different listing samples, not a measured location adjustment for the same vehicle.

Observed spread: up to $8,203

2020 Ram 1500: a fair price for your mileage

Mileage means the miles recorded on the odometer. Compare asking prices in your mileage band, then select a trim — the equipment version — to narrow the comparison where data is available.

Across the national mileage bands, the overall difference is roughly $900 per 10,000 miles. These are different vehicles, not depreciation of the same car.

Frequently asked questions

Why do 2020 Ram 1500 prices range from $15,995 to $40,950?

The spread comes down to configuration and mileage: higher-mileage, base-configuration examples sit near the low end, while low-mileage and premium configurations reach the top. Half of all listings fall between $24,662 and $32,696 — see the mileage and trim breakdowns above for where a specific vehicle lands.

How much should mileage change the price of a 2020 Ram 1500?

Across the lowest- and highest-mileage groups, asking prices differ by roughly $900 per 10,000 miles. These groups contain different vehicles: this is not a same-trim adjustment or a forecast for one car. Compare the mileage and trim tables, then check condition, equipment and vehicle history.

How many 2020 Ram 1500 are for sale right now?

4,151 in total, nearly all pre-owned. Counts refresh daily from live dealer inventory.

Is this the trade-in value or private-party value of my 2020 Ram 1500?

These figures describe dealer asking prices, not trade-in offers, private-party sale values or completed sale prices. Use them to compare advertised vehicles. How we calculate these prices

We track 4,151 active listings for this vehicle across dealer sites nationwide, updated every day. Average and median are computed from real asking prices on live listings. We exclude the top and bottom 2% of prices to reduce the influence of extreme values. This does not verify title status or guarantee that every erroneous listing is excluded. Prices reflect dealer asking prices — not final sale prices — and exclude taxes, fees, and incentives. Trim and mileage move the price more than any other factor; see the breakdowns above.
